WebNonionic Emulsifying Wax is a synthetic emulsifying wax made from Cetearyl alcohol and Polysorbate 60 (as defined in the USP-NF), or Cetostearyl alcohol and Polyethylene glycol hexadecyl ether (as defined in the B.P). Nonionic emulsifying wax is supplied in the form of a white or off-white waxy solid or flaky material that exhibits a faint odour. WebSep 1, 2013 · Furthermore, under 1 week water-submerged condition, the values of their diffusivity for wax J, wax K and wax M are estimated as 3.06×10−12 cm2/s, 7.23×10−11 … WebJun 9, 2009 · Four basic oil types were used: esters, mineral oil, vegetable oil and a silicone cross-polymer. These were used in conjunction with a range of polyethylene waxes, plant waxes, petrochemical waxes and solid esters with each wax added at 30% into the oils. The wax and oil were heated, mixed and poured into a lipstick mould to form sticks. WebJojoba Esters can be used to substitute a portion of wax in a balm, butter, or bath melt formula to reduce its heaviness. They can also be used in creams or lotions to help thicken or stiffen the emulsions. They are available in a variety of hardnesses.
